The Bitter Buddha Trailer

The Bitter Buddha Trailer (2012)

15 June 2012 Factual 92 mins

The Documentary takes an unconventional journey through the life of one of America's most original comedic voices. Eddie Pepitone, "The Bitter Buddha", is looked at in this portrait of creativity, enlightenment and rage.
